We live in a world where it’s easier than ever to buy clothes with a single tap. But before you hit “Add to Cart,” taking just a few seconds to ask yourself three simple questions can save you money, reduce clutter, and help you build a wardrobe you’ll actually love.

Whether you’re shopping new or secondhand, these questions will help you make smarter purchases every time.

1. Will I Actually Wear It?

This might seem obvious, but it’s the question most shoppers skip.

Instead of imagining a fantasy version of yourself, think about your real life.

Ask yourself:

  • Can I think of at least three places I’d wear this?
  • Does it match clothes I already own?
  • Would I reach for it next week if it were hanging in my closet?
  • Is it comfortable enough for how I actually dress?

If you have to invent a future occasion to justify buying it, it may not deserve a spot in your wardrobe.

2. Is It Made to Last?

Not all clothing is created equal. A lower price doesn’t always mean a better value if the item falls apart after a few wears.

Look for quality details like:

  • Strong, even stitching
  • Durable fabrics with a substantial feel
  • Secure buttons and zippers
  • Pattern alignment at seams
  • Minimal loose threads
  • Clean interior finishing

Natural fibers like cotton, linen, silk, and wool often age beautifully, but many modern blends can also offer excellent durability when they’re well made.

A garment that lasts for years is almost always a better investment than one you’ll replace every season.

3. Is It Worth the Price?

Instead of focusing only on the price tag, think about cost per wear.

For example:

  • A $20 shirt worn twice costs $10 per wear.
  • A $60 shirt worn 60 times costs just $1 per wear.

The item you wear over and over again becomes the better value—even if it costs more upfront.

This simple shift in thinking helps you buy fewer, better pieces while avoiding impulse purchases you’ll regret later.

Your Smart Clothing Checklist

Before you buy, run through this quick checklist:

✔ I’ll wear it often.

✔ It works with my current wardrobe.

✔ The quality looks and feels solid.

✔ The fabric fits my lifestyle.

✔ The price makes sense for how much I’ll use it.

✔ I’d still buy it if it weren’t on sale.

If you can confidently check every box, you’re probably making a smart purchase.
